Ok, now for my installation experiences:
I put the Inst cd (#1) in my Plextor SCSI2 CDROM and booted -- it booted off
of the CD, and the installation asked which CDROM I wanted to use (hdc|sdc)
-- I chose sdc and it tried to initialize the CDROM. The cdrom light came on,
and every 10 seconds I would hear a "clicking" sound. Eventually, the
installer timed out with an "Invalid argument" error and when it couldn't
mount the Ramdisk, it rebooted the computer.
I then swapped the CD to the DVD drive, and it booted off of it just fine,
and installation went very well after that.

Ok, now for post installation:
During first boot up, a "Failed" message popped up for INND - citing "No such
file or directory" for "execvp". I turned this off in system services, since
I'm not running a News Server, but you may want to take a look at this for
those who will be.
LICQ didn't work properly -- I turned the dock icon on, and clicked "apply"
and it seg faulted (same thing happened after restarting it 2 or 3 more times
and trying again). To test whether this was Mandrake specific, or a problem
with the app, I went out to www.licq.org, and downloaded the latest source
file. I removed all of the licq rpm packages and installed the source file,
and ran that one -- it didn't have a problem at all with the dock icon (it's
running right now). Also, you might want to take a look at the qt-gui plugin
configure option "--with-kde" -- since this distribution is KDE2 based, you
might want to turn that on, if you haven't already.
